From ea6619f452c26eb1c0bad419e47b81ac51357608 Mon Sep 17 00:00:00 2001 From: Constance Chen Date: Tue, 11 Apr 2023 18:35:54 -0700 Subject: [PATCH] [EuiSuperDatePicker] Fix border-radius & remove unnecessary CSS/overrides --- .../super_date_picker/_super_date_picker.scss | 13 +------------ .../date_popover/_date_popover_button.scss | 4 ++-- src/themes/amsterdam/overrides/_date_picker.scss | 10 ---------- .../amsterdam/overrides/_date_popover_button.scss | 14 -------------- src/themes/amsterdam/overrides/_index.scss | 1 - 5 files changed, 3 insertions(+), 39 deletions(-) delete mode 100644 src/themes/amsterdam/overrides/_date_popover_button.scss diff --git a/src/components/date_picker/super_date_picker/_super_date_picker.scss b/src/components/date_picker/super_date_picker/_super_date_picker.scss index 3d809ca25f2..66c53d8764a 100644 --- a/src/components/date_picker/super_date_picker/_super_date_picker.scss +++ b/src/components/date_picker/super_date_picker/_super_date_picker.scss @@ -43,21 +43,10 @@ overflow: hidden; background-color: $euiFormBackgroundColor; - > .euiDatePickerRange { - max-width: none; - width: auto; + &:last-child { border-radius: 0 $euiFormControlBorderRadius $euiFormControlBorderRadius 0; } - &:not(:last-child) > .euiDatePickerRange { - &, - .euiDatePopoverButton--end, - .euiSuperDatePicker__prettyFormat { - border-top-right-radius: 0; - border-bottom-right-radius: 0; - } - } - & > .euiFormControlLayoutDelimited__input { flex-grow: 1; } diff --git a/src/components/date_picker/super_date_picker/date_popover/_date_popover_button.scss b/src/components/date_picker/super_date_picker/date_popover/_date_popover_button.scss index 5042743941c..96f20dde83b 100644 --- a/src/components/date_picker/super_date_picker/date_popover/_date_popover_button.scss +++ b/src/components/date_picker/super_date_picker/date_popover/_date_popover_button.scss @@ -44,9 +44,9 @@ } .euiDatePopoverButton--start { - text-align: right; + text-align: center; } .euiDatePopoverButton--end { - text-align: left; + text-align: center; } diff --git a/src/themes/amsterdam/overrides/_date_picker.scss b/src/themes/amsterdam/overrides/_date_picker.scss index a2bc8ea1b50..aebe13a68d4 100644 --- a/src/themes/amsterdam/overrides/_date_picker.scss +++ b/src/themes/amsterdam/overrides/_date_picker.scss @@ -11,13 +11,3 @@ .euiDatePicker.euiDatePicker--shadow.euiDatePicker--inline .react-datepicker { border: none; } - -.euiSuperDatePicker__prettyFormat { - border-top-right-radius: $euiFormControlBorderRadius; - border-bottom-right-radius: $euiFormControlBorderRadius; -} - -.euiFormControlLayout--compressed.euiSuperDatePicker .euiSuperDatePicker__prettyFormat { - border-top-right-radius: $euiFormControlCompressedBorderRadius; - border-bottom-right-radius: $euiFormControlCompressedBorderRadius; -} diff --git a/src/themes/amsterdam/overrides/_date_popover_button.scss b/src/themes/amsterdam/overrides/_date_popover_button.scss deleted file mode 100644 index 6b5d91cd27f..00000000000 --- a/src/themes/amsterdam/overrides/_date_popover_button.scss +++ /dev/null @@ -1,14 +0,0 @@ -.euiDatePopoverButton--start { - text-align: center; -} - -.euiDatePopoverButton--end { - text-align: center; - border-top-right-radius: $euiFormControlBorderRadius; - border-bottom-right-radius: $euiFormControlBorderRadius; - - &.euiDatePopoverButton--compressed { - border-top-right-radius: $euiFormControlCompressedBorderRadius; - border-bottom-right-radius: $euiFormControlCompressedBorderRadius; - } -} diff --git a/src/themes/amsterdam/overrides/_index.scss b/src/themes/amsterdam/overrides/_index.scss index f3c16fa9c2f..7fb853f7628 100644 --- a/src/themes/amsterdam/overrides/_index.scss +++ b/src/themes/amsterdam/overrides/_index.scss @@ -1,7 +1,6 @@ @import 'combo_box'; @import 'data_grid'; @import 'date_picker'; -@import 'date_popover_button'; @import 'description_list'; @import 'filter_group'; @import 'form_control_layout';